Rockwell table leg set from Peter Meier, Inc. provides a matching set of four support legs designed for work surfaces and tables where a consistent look and height matter. The 3 inch diameter legs create a sturdy vertical support profile that distributes loads over a wider tube, which is useful on heavier tops in shop or commercial settings. Each leg stands 34-1/2 inches high, giving you a work surface or table height suited to standard counter-height projects when paired with typical top thicknesses. The chrome finish gives the legs a clean, uniform appearance that works well in customer-facing or shop environments where exposed structural parts remain visible. The set format keeps all four points of support on the same specification, helping maintain level alignment across corners and edges during installation and use.
The 4 9/16 inch (116 mm) square mounting plate on each leg provides a defined interface to the underside of the work surface or table, which helps spread load over a larger area of the top. The square plate shape offers simple orientation against cabinet lines or top edges, which is helpful when laying out consistent corner positions. Each leg features a 1 1/8 inch adjustable foot, so the installed height can be fine tuned within that range to address typical floor unevenness. This adjustment range lets you bring multiple legs into the same plane after fastening, supporting solid contact under all corners and reducing rocking under working loads.
